What is the name of Estero Franco's airport?
Chetumal Intl. Airport (CTM) is the sole airport in Estero Franco.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Check carefully that you don't have sharp objects (like a knife or scissors) hiding in the bottom of your carry-on luggage. Other banned items include flammable or explosive goods, like aerosols and matches, and gels and liquids in containers with a capacity of more than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).

  • A serious condition known as DVT (deep vein thrombosis) is a risk on long-haul flights. It's the result of blood clotting due to inactivity and poor circulation. Doing foot and leg exercises while seated helps to prevent this developing. Wearing a good pair of compression socks or tights can also help.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Estero Franco?
The answer is — be prepared. We've rounded up some useful tips for a stress-free trip through airport security. Watch out Estero Franco, here you come:

  • Be sure to have your travel documents and ID within easy reach. They're the first things you'll be asked to show at airport security.
  • After that, both you and your hand luggage will be X-rayed. To speed things up, take off anything that might set the alarms off. Personal belongings like your belt, coat and headphones will be required to go through the machine.
  • All your electronics, including your laptop and phone, will also need to be scanned separately.
  • Remove liquids and gels from your carry-on bag. They often need to be sent through the X-ray separately. Each item should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it in a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• Choosing your footwear wisely can save you several precious minutes. Boots and heavy shoes are often required to be removed and separately scanned. Lightweight sneakers are usually not.
  • Take all prohibited items out of your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, pack them in your checked baggage. They won't be allowed on board and will be confiscated.
